Overview
- Tierheim Köln‑Dellbrück is caring for 17 cats from a 48‑cat apartment seizure, most of them Scottish Folds with several pregnant females and expected litters of roughly 20–25 kittens, with some animals in quarantine and an appeal for donations underway.
- Tierheim Bergheim took in 23 Yorkshire Terriers from filthy, overcrowded housing; one rescued female later gave birth in foster care, the group includes serious medical cases, and after veterinary clearance for adoption the shelter must cover all ongoing costs.
- A Scottish Fold named Ariel was handed to Tierheim Essen during labor and delivered five healthy kittens, with the shelter emphasizing the breed’s welfare issues linked to a genetic mutation.
- Tierheim Bochum is hand‑rearing six orphaned kittens after their mother died, two have already died, and the shelter is asking for a specific Royal Canin kitten milk to continue round‑the‑clock care.
- Customs at Cologne/Bonn seized pets smuggled from Turkey, including a kitten called Badem now held under strict isolation at Tierheim Köln‑Dellbrück, highlighting the heavy quarantine burden on shelters.
